WebFeb 11, 2024 · their work clearly showed how the resistance of the resistor approximated to 400Ω. Weaker students knew to use Ohm’s Law and often rearranged this correctly with a valid data substitution to gain 2 marks, but struggled to make further progress due to not converting milliamps to amps. Q6(b) was poorly answered by all but the most able students. WebMar 5, 2024 · (b) (i) Graph drawing skills were generally excellent. Many students gained at least four marks and produced fully labelled graphs that had linear scales, accurate plotting and neat, straight lines that joined the points. Most students chose linear scales for the vertical axis that had sensible increments that enabled easy plotting of the points.
